Skip to main content
Log in

Mehrstufige Auswahldisziplin in einem M/G/1-Processor-sharing-System mit Prioritäten

Multilevel processor-sharing algorithm for M/G/1 systems with priorities

  • Published:
Computing Aims and scope Submit manuscript

Zusammenfassung

Die bekannte mehrstufige Processor-sharing-Disziplin in M/G/1-Systemen ohne Prioritäten wird auf M/G/1-Systeme mit Prioritäten erweitert und untersucht. Dabei wird die mittlere VerweilzeitT j (x) und die mittlere WartezeitW j (x) für einen Auftrag derj-Klasse mitx sec Servicebedarf analytisch berechnet. An Hand einiger graphischer Darstellungen wird die Abhängigkeit der FunktionenT j (x) undW j (x) von der Prioritätsklasse und der Stufenanzahl veranschaulicht. Ferner wird die in der Literatur noch nicht behandelte Foreground-Background-Disziplin mit Prioritäten als Spezialfall der mehrstufigen Processor-sharing-Disziplin untersucht.

Abstract

In this paper the well-known multilevel processor-sharing algorithm for M/G/1 systems without priorities is extended to M/G/1 systems with priority classes. The average response timeT j (x) and the average waiting timeW j (x) for aj-class job, which requires a total service ofx sec, is analytically calculated. Some figures demonstrate, how the priority classes and the total number of the different levels affect the behavior of the functionsT j (x) andW j (x). In addition, the foreground-background algorithm with priorities, which is in the literature not yet covered, is treated as a special case of the multilevel processor-sharing algorithm.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Literatur

  • [Fisz 78] Fisz, F.: Wahrscheinlichkeitsrechnung und mathematische Statistik. Berlin: Deutscher Verlag der Wissenschaften 1978.

    Google Scholar 

  • [Grab 68] Grabill, T. B.: Sufficient conditions for positive recurrence of specially structured Markovchains. Oper. Res.16, 858–867 (1968).

    Google Scholar 

  • [Klei 64] Kleinrock, L.: Analysis of a time-scared processor. Naval Research Logistics Quarterly11, 59–73 (1974).

    Google Scholar 

  • [Klei 70] Kleinrock, L., Muntz, R. R.: Multilevel processor-scaring queueing models for time-scared models. Proc. 6th Intern. Teletr. Cogd. 341/1–341/8, August 1970.

  • [Klei 71] Kleinrock, L., Muntz, R. R., Rodemich, E.: The processor-scaring queueing model for timescared systems with bulk arrivals. Network Journal1, 1–13 (1971).

    Google Scholar 

  • [Klei 76] Kleinrock, L.: Queueing systems, vol. II: computer applications. New York: Wiley Interscience 1976.

    Google Scholar 

  • [Odon 74] O'Donovan, T. M.: Direct solutions of M/G/1-processor-sharing models. Oper. Res.22, 1232–1235 (1974).

    Google Scholar 

  • [Yass 76] Yassouridis, A.: Hinreichende Bedingungen für die Existenz von Grenzverteilungen in verschiedenen Warteschlangenmodellen. U. B. M. Congres d. Mathematiques Appliquees, Thessalonique Aou. (1976).

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

About this article

Cite this article

Yassouridis, A., Koller, R. Mehrstufige Auswahldisziplin in einem M/G/1-Processor-sharing-System mit Prioritäten. Computing 30, 1–18 (1983). https://doi.org/10.1007/BF02253292

Download citation

  • Received: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F02253292

Navigation